MMP1P68K-F Film Capacitor Equivalent & Substitute Parts

Part Overview

The MMP1P68K-F is a 0.68 µF film capacitor manufactured by Cornell Dubilier Electronics (CDE), designed for general-purpose applications requiring reliable performance across industrial temperature ranges. This axial-mounted through-hole component operates at 100V DC with polyester metallized dielectric construction. Substitute Part Grouping Explanation

Substitute parts for the MMP1P68K-F are identified based on strict electrical and mechanical equivalence. The substitution logic requires:

Mandatory Matching Parameters:

  • Capacitance value: 0.68 µF (exact match)
  • DC voltage rating: 100V minimum
  • Dielectric material: Polyester, Metallized
  • Mounting type: Through Hole, Axial
  • Termination: PC Pins
  • Operating temperature range: -55°C ~ 125°C or better
  • RoHS compliance: ROHS3 Compliant

Acceptable Variations:

  • Tolerance: ±5% is acceptable as a tighter specification than ±10%
  • AC voltage rating: May vary within design margins
  • Physical dimensions: Minor variations acceptable if mounting compatibility maintained
  • Packaging format: Bulk or standard packaging acceptable

The substitute part 150684J100FC meets all mandatory parameters while offering improved tolerance specification (±5% versus ±10%), making it functionally equivalent for circuit applications.

Frequently Asked Questions (FAQ)

Q: Can 150684J100FC replace MMP1P68K-F in existing designs? A: Yes. Both parts share identical capacitance (0.68 µF), voltage rating (100V DC), dielectric material (polyester metallized), operating temperature range (-55°C ~ 125°C), and mounting configuration (through-hole axial). The substitute offers improved tolerance (±5% versus ±10%).

Q: What is the difference in physical size between these parts? A: MMP1P68K-F dimensions are 0.433" W × 0.256" T × 0.906" L (11.00mm × 6.50mm × 23.00mm). The 150684J100FC measures 0.335" diameter × 0.807" L (8.50mm × 20.50mm). The substitute is more compact. Verify PCB layout compatibility before substitution.

Q: Are both parts RoHS compliant? A: Yes. Both MMP1P68K-F and 150684J100FC are ROHS3 compliant and REACH unaffected, meeting current regulatory requirements.

Q: What does the ±5% tolerance improvement mean for circuit performance? A: The 150684J100FC tolerance of ±5% provides tighter capacitance accuracy compared to the ±10% specification of MMP1P68K-F. This reduces capacitance variation across production batches, beneficial for precision filtering, timing, or frequency-dependent applications.

Q: Can I use these parts interchangeably in production? A: Both parts are suitable for through-hole PCB assembly with identical electrical performance at rated specifications. Verify mechanical fit given the dimensional differences, particularly lead spacing and component body diameter relative to your PCB hole layout.

Q: What is the moisture sensitivity level for both parts? A: Both parts carry MSL 1 (Unlimited), indicating no moisture sensitivity restrictions during storage or handling.
